About
Fondazione Elisabetta Germani ETS has been caring for the elderly and adults with disability for 125 years in Cingia de' Botti, a small village in Lombardia. Being rooted in this territory means we work closely with families, citizens and the whole local community.
We manage a multi-service structure offering residential, semi-residential and home-care services. Overall, we count 12 units, including a Nursing Home, a specialized Alzheimer's Center, Intermediate Care, and a Unit for Disability at residential level, a Day-Care Center at semi-residential level and Outpatient clinics — supporting over 300 patients and 200 families with a team of 280+ professionals.
Our particular area of excellence is the Dementia Supply Chain, combining clinical care with research on age-friendly environments and innovative technologies.
Our Living Lab makes the Foundation's patients, caregivers and care settings available to external partners for co-designing, testing and validating new products, services and technologies. This includes digital health tools as well as organizational and environmental innovations.
